The two states where he didn't do as expected: Florida (he was leading by 1-2 points in several polls going into Election Day) and North Carolina (where John Edwards didn't help whatsoever).  He was competitive in Nevada but fell short.    Interestingly, there's some discussion in the 2004 section that discusses West Virginia--in which Kerry was initially within range (how times have changed!) but pulled out resources early.

In hindsight, however, Kerry did rather well--had a significant GOTV effort (the Republicans did as well and had several anti-gay initiatives in states that got out their base).    He wasn't the greatest candidate but he did well in the debates--and he came within 118,000 votes to take Ohio and the election (and he did overperform in much of the Midwest).
